on my sun keyboard the enter key is about the same size as the shift key.
When I want to mark multiple message using shift-selection, but  	accidentally
press and hold the enter key mozilla-mail opens the same message over and over
again in new windows (due to key-repeat).
This is quite annoying as my sun is not the fatest and it can happen to take me
5 minutes to get rid of them all.

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. press and hold enter in the message list
2.
3.

Actual Results:  
the longer you do that the more windows you will have

Expected Results:  
One message should only be opened once.
